Responsible for executing cybersecurity projects, supporting planning efforts, and serving as a project or team lead to ensure high‑quality delivery. Work with the latest security tools and cyber risk management approaches and oversee the technical work of junior‑level personnel, as well as set performance expectations. Collaborate with other project leads, managers, and/or executives to communicate business and technical aspects of the work being performed and assist the engagement economics of the projects, including budget status tracking, billing, and collection analysis.
Will lead technical engagements in the following areas and responsibilities:
- Client Delivery
- Internal Development
- Business / Market Development
Minimum 40% domestic travel required for client projects.
Position is based in Houston, TX and reports to Houston office. WFH available up to 3‑days a week.
RequirementsRequires a Bachelor’s degree in Information Technology and Management, Information Systems, Cybersecurity, Computer Science, foreign equivalent or closely related field. Position requires five (5) years of experience in job offered, Senior Consultant, Technology Consulting, or related occupation within consulting or professional services. Position requires experience in:
Information Security and Risk Management;
Cybersecurity frameworks including NIST or ISO;
Data Protection and Endpoint Security;
Incident Management, IT Asset Management, and Configuration Management, Threat and Vulnerability Management;
Network Security Practices:
Auditing, planning, design, implementation, testing, and management;
Network architecture and protocols; and Cryptographic tools, suites, and algorithms.
Information security certification such as Certified Information Systems Security Professional (CISSP) or Off Sec Certified Professional (OSCP) required.
